The instance of gnome-shell getting killed isn't shown in the logs. Only
the instances that came after the kill are mentioned. So based on the
behaviour of the gnome-shell processes that *didn't* get killed, it
looks like they are using a realtime thread:

  Made thread 'KMS thread' realtime scheduled

which means they may be SIGKILLed by the kernel if they don't perform
perfectly. This was tracked in bug 2077216 and fixed in mutter version
46.5 onward.

So this is either a duplicate of bug 2077216, or OOM. Let's assume the
former.
